Pay With Flex FAQs

Trek Bikes Florida has partnered with Flex to allow you to use your Health Savings Account (HSA) or Flexible Spending Account (FSA). This means you can now use your HSA or FSA debit card to purchase eligible bikes with pre-tax dollars, which may result in net savings of approximately 30–40%, depending on your tax bracket.

To use your HSA or FSA debit card, simply add products to your cart as usual. At checkout, select “Flex | Pay with HSA/FSA” as your payment option, enter your HSA or FSA debit card information, and complete your purchase as normal. If you do not see “Flex | Pay with HSA/FSA” as an option, you may be checking out through Shop Pay. In that case, select “Checkout as Guest” to view additional payment options.

The key is to make sure you are logged out of Shop Pay. One of the easiest ways to do this is to go through checkout in an incognito window or simply select “Check out as guest” in the footer of the checkout page.

If you do not have your HSA or FSA card available, you can still select “Flex | Pay with HSA/FSA” as your payment method. Simply enter your credit card information, and Flex will email you an itemized receipt that you can submit for reimbursement.

Sales tax for eligible items can also be covered by HSA/FSA funds. If the customer has a split cart, the tax will be divided between the payment methods based on the items purchased.

Some products require documentation from a licensed healthcare provider confirming that the item is necessary to treat or manage a specific medical condition. If a product requires a Letter of Medical Necessity (LOMN), Flex offers a chat-based consultation that can generate the letter in real time.

To qualify to use your HSA or FSA card for approved products, the IRS requires a Letter of Medical Necessity. Trek Bikes Florida has partnered with Flex to offer asynchronous telehealth visits as part of the checkout process. Within 24 hours of your purchase, Flex will email you an itemized receipt.

You should keep it on file for at least three years in case of an IRS audit of your HSA or FSA account. In some cases, FSA administrators may also request the letter to confirm the eligibility of your purchase.

We strongly recommend checking with your HSA or FSA provider before completing your purchase to confirm whether the item is eligible.
